Satakunnan Kansa Länsi-Suomi is a Finnish regional daily newspaper based in Pori. Formed by the merger of two long-standing publications, it provides comprehensive coverage of the Satakunta region, including Pori and Rauma. The publication focuses on local news, politics, culture, economy, and community events across western Finland.

MEDIA LANDSCAPE IN PORI

Serving as the media hub for the Satakunta region, the local newspaper market is anchored by a primary daily publication and supplemented by smaller political and free weekly titles. The leading paper is Satakunnan Kansa, a regional Finnish-language daily that has circulated since 1873. Print distribution also includes Satakunnan Viikko, a free weekly community paper, and Uusi Aika, a Finnish-language newspaper with historical ties to the regional social democratic movement.
